Why Stocking Density Matters
When an aquarium is set up, it mimics a closed environment. Unlike a natural lake or river, waste does not remove with the current. Instead, fish waste, leftover food, and decomposing plant matter break down into ammonia, an extremely hazardous compound.
Beneficial germs (the nitrogen cycle) convert ammonia into nitrites and then into less hazardous nitrates. Nevertheless, these bacteria can only process a limited amount of waste. If a tank is overstocked, the biological filter becomes overwhelmed, causing ammonia spikes.
Appropriate equipping makes sure:
- Optimal Water Quality: Less biological load suggests stable specifications.
- Lowered Stress: Fish have sufficient area, lowering hostility and illness susceptibility.
- Oxygen Availability: More fish take Calculate Litres In Fish Tank oxygen much faster; correct stocking prevents nighttime hypoxia (low oxygen).
The Evolution of the "One Inch Per Gallon" Rule
For years, the aquarium hobby relied greatly on a basic guideline of thumb: "One inch of Fish Tank Gallon Calculator per gallon of water."
While easy to keep in mind, this guideline is alarmingly flawed. Think about the following limitations:
- Body Mass and Waste: A 3-inch goldfish produces significantly more waste and consumes more oxygen than a 3-inch neon tetra due to its bulkier body and biological makeup.
- Activity Level: Active swimmers (like Danios) require a lot more swimming space than sedentary bottom-dwellers (like Corydoras), despite length.
- Filtering Capacity: A greatly filtered tank can handle a slightly greater biological load than a bare-bones setup.
This is why modern aquarists depend on digital aquarium equipping calculators instead of out-of-date blanket guidelines.
How a Fish Tank Stocking Calculator Works
A quality stocking calculator does not just look at the Volume Of Aquarium Calculator of your tank; it examines several interconnected variables to give a practical assessment of your tank's capacity.
Secret Factors Analyzed by Calculators:
- Tank Dimensions: Surface area is typically more vital than total gallon capability since gas exchange takes place at the water's surface.
- Filtering Type: The circulation rate and media capacity of the filter heavily influence the biological load limitation.
- Fish Temperament and Swimming Zones: Calculators consider whether Fish Tank Weight Calculator dwell on top, middle, or bottom of the tank.
- Adult Size: Calculators utilize the adult size of the fish, not the size at the pet store.

Tips for Maintaining a Properly Stocked Aquarium
Once your Calculate Aquarium Size stocking calculator provides you the thumbs-up, your work is only beginning. Equipping density is dynamic and requires continuous management.
- Stock Slowly: Never include your full bio-load simultaneously. Include a couple of fish every 2-- 3 weeks to provide your beneficial germs colony time to multiply and catch up to the increased waste production.
- Represent Fry: Live-bearing fish like Guppies, Platies, and Mollies reproduce rapidly. If you keep mixed-gender livebearers, your 75% stocked tank can become a 200% equipped tank in a matter of months.
- Purchase Reliable Water Testing Kits: A calculator is a preparation tool, not a crystal ball. Routine screening for ammonia, nitrite, nitrate, and pH is the ultimate sign of whether your equipping level is really sustainable.
- Stay up to date with Water Changes: Even the best-calculated tanks need routine upkeep. A weekly 20% to 30% water change eliminates collected nitrates and renews important minerals.
